Biggera Waters Foreshore is a relaxed, family-favourite spot along the calm Broadwater on the northern Gold Coast. This sheltered foreshore offers shallow, protected waters perfect for young kids, picnics, playground fun, and peaceful walks with water views. It’s especially loved for its highly dog-friendly off-leash swimming times, resident wildlife like black swans, and the nearby Ian Dipple Lagoon — a natural sandy lagoon great for little ones to splash safely. (Also known as Biggera Waters Beach / Marine Parade foreshore, adjacent to Quota Park and near Ian Dipple Lagoon)

Beach Information

  • 🌟 Best Time to Visit: Year-round for the calm Broadwater vibe! September to April for warmer swimming and picnics; mild winters still ideal for walks, playgrounds, and wildlife spotting.
  • 🪼 Marine Stingers: Very low risk in the sheltered Broadwater — no major issues like box jellyfish or Irukandji found on open ocean beaches. The enclosed lagoon areas provide extra safe, stinger-free fun for families.
  • 🚩 Lifeguard Patrol: No formal patrols (calm, protected waters), but the shallow foreshore and lagoon are considered very safe for kids and casual swimming.
  • 🐶 Dog Friendly: Highly popular with dog owners! Mostly on-leash in park areas, but a dedicated off-leash swimming and exercise zone along the foreshore (adjacent to Quota Park, from near Burrows Street southwards) is open daily from 5am–8am and 4pm–7pm — perfect for pups to splash in calm waters. Dogs prohibited in playgrounds and any signed zones — always check signs and clean up after your pet.
  • 🛠️ Facilities: Toilets, showers, BBQs, picnic shelters, cafes, playground.
  • ♿ Accessibility: Wheelchair-accessible pathways along the esplanade, accessible playground features at Quota Park, and some matting near water edges for easier access.
  • 🏘️ Closest Town: Biggera Waters — Distance: 0 km
  • ✈️ Closest Airport: Gold Coast Airport — Distance: 35 km
  • 🌦️ Typical Weather: Subtropical; hot, humid summers and mild winters with ocean breezes.

🏖️Things to Do at Biggera Waters Foreshore

  • 🏊 Swimming & Lagoon Fun: Shallow, calm waters along the foreshore; head to the natural Ian Dipple Lagoon (nearby at Labrador/Biggera border) for super-safe splashing — perfect for toddlers and little kids with its sandy, enclosed feel. Calm shallow waters make it ideal for paddle boarding and kayaking.
  • 🚶 Foreshore Walks: Paved paths along Marine Parade for easy strolls, jogging, or enjoying Broadwater views (great for prams or wheelchairs too). 🐕 Dog-Friendly Fun: Off-leash swimming and play during designated hours (5–8am & 4–7pm) — calm waters make it ideal for dogs to paddle and socialise.
  • 🍔 Picnics & BBQs: Shaded picnic areas, free BBQs, and tables at Quota Park and along the foreshore.
  • 🎪 Playground Time: Nautical-themed playground at Quota Park with swings, slides, climbing, and equipment for all ages.
  • 🏋️ Exercise & Volleyball: Outdoor fitness gear and open spaces for casual games.
  • 🐟 Wildlife Watching & Pelican Feeding: Spot resident black swans gliding by; don’t miss the daily pelican feeding at 1:30pm at nearby Ian Dipple Lagoon — hundreds of pelicans flock for fish scraps from local seafood spots!

🗺️ Getting There

🚗 Driving: On Marine Parade, Biggera Waters — easy via Oxley Drive or Runaway Bay. Free parking along the esplanade and near Quota Park.
🚌 Public Transport: TransLink buses serve Marine Parade; stops nearby.
🚲 Parking: Ample free spots — arrive early for pelican feeding crowds.

💡 Local Tips

🦢 Spot the Resident Black Swans: Biggera Waters Foreshore often has beautiful black swans patrolling the Broadwater and grassy edges — a peaceful local highlight! Watch them glide (respectful distance, no feeding) especially early morning or late afternoon.
🌴 Feels like a locals’ haven — quieter than southern beaches, with shallow lagoons perfect for tiny tots and relaxed family vibes.
🐟 Great for casual fishing or marine life spotting from the shore.
☕ Grab fish & chips from nearby spots (Charis Seafoods is legendary) and picnic by the water.
🐶 Time your visit for off-leash dog hours to let pups run free in the calm shallows.
🕜 Don’t miss the daily pelican feeding at 1:30pm at Ian Dipple Lagoon — arrive early for a good spot and parking!
🌅 Walk the path for sunrise/sunset views across the Broadwater.
